Thunder Advances to Western Conference Finals with Victory Over Nuggets

The Oklahoma City Thunder demonstrated their prowess on the court by overcoming the Denver Nuggets in a decisive 125-93 victory during Game 7 of the Western Conference semifinals, earning a spot in the finals. This marks the Thunder’s first appearance in the conference finals since 2016.

Key Performers Shine for Oklahoma City

Shai Gilgeous-Alexander led the Thunder with an impressive 35 points, while Jalen Williams contributed significantly with 24 points. Their performances underscored the team’s dominance, particularly in crucial moments of the game.

A Historic Season and Playoff Journey

The Thunder concluded the regular season with the league’s best record, clinching 68 wins. This achievement came after last year’s disappointment, where they were eliminated in the conference semifinals as the top seed by the Dallas Mavericks.

Challenges Presented by the Nuggets

Oklahoma City faced a formidable opponent in the Denver Nuggets, led by three-time MVP Nikola Jokic, who scored 20 points and grabbed 9 rebounds. The Nuggets, fresh from a playoff victory over the LA Clippers, showcased their resilience but were ultimately unable to keep pace with the Thunder.

Game Highlights and Turning Points

The Thunder began the match sluggishly, trailing by 11 points in the first quarter. However, a remarkable second quarter saw them outscore the Nuggets 39-20, establishing a solid 60-46 halftime lead.

Early in the third quarter, Denver’s Aaron Gordon received a flagrant foul for elbowing Gilgeous-Alexander, who capitalized by making both resulting free throws. This momentum shift helped Oklahoma City further extend their lead.

A fast break concluded with a powerful dunk by Cason Wallace over Jokic, intensifying the crowd’s excitement and pushing the Thunder to a commanding 78-57 advantage.

Looking Ahead: Western Conference Finals

As the top seed, the Thunder will now host the sixth-seeded Minnesota Timberwolves, starting Tuesday. With their sights set on the championship, Oklahoma City aims to build on this victory and demonstrate their playoff readiness.
